Finding the Best Drama & Theater Arts School for You

With 82 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, drama and theater arts is the #69 most popular major in Rhode Island.

There are lots of options to pick from today when trying to decide which program is right for you. With more and more schools offering online options, you could even register for a great program on the other side of the country. On top of that, there are a considerable number of trade schools that offer fast-track entry to many fields.

Along with in-depth profiles of schools and the programs they offer, Course Advisor has created the Best Drama & Theater Arts Schools in Rhode Island to help you in your search for the best school for you. Our analysis looked at 3 schools in Rhode Island to see which programs offered the best educational experiences for students.

Brown University

Providence, RI

Our analysis found Brown University to be the best school for drama and theater arts students who want to pursue a degree in Rhode Island. Brown is a fairly large private not-for-profit school located in the medium-sized city of Providence.

Out of the 3 schools in Rhode Island that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Rhode Island landed the # 2 spot on the list. Located in the large suburb of Kingston, URI is a public college with a large student population.

After completing their degree, theater graduates from URI carry an average student debtload of $27,000.

Rhode Island College

Providence, RI

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around you if you attend Rhode Island College. The school came in at #3 on this year’s Best Drama & Theater Arts Schools in Rhode Island list. Located in the suburb of Providence, RIC is a public school with a moderately-sized student population.

On average, theater graduates from RIC take out $24,772 in student loans while working on their degree.
